diff options
author | Long Ling <longling@google.com> | 2022-03-14 21:10:18 +0000 |
---|---|---|
committer |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com> | 2022-03-14 21:10:18 +0000 |
commit | ad2121120566776d1da6a516009233b4fae8c4e2 (patch) | |
tree | b25cd331ca2da9e1858d65a9db433fc9a385a1f8 | |
parent | 2ad8099c9424c5b224e534c2f8f94c9c890ee2cd (diff) | |
parent | c083cbd249801a8225c255a2b5a497a40c08bff5 (diff) | |
download | gs101-ad2121120566776d1da6a516009233b4fae8c4e2.tar.gz |
Merge "libhwc2.1: pass hdr layer with null metadata to displaycolor" into tm-dev am: c083cbd249
Original change: https://googleplex-android-review.googlesource.com/c/platform/hardware/google/graphics/gs101/+/17156654
Change-Id: I7e4c8843c8337f3c58c84002f917f2bb33a494a6
-rw-r--r-- | libhwc2.1/libmaindisplay/ExynosPrimaryDisplayModule.cpp | 6 |
1 files changed, 1 insertions, 5 deletions
diff --git a/libhwc2.1/libmaindisplay/ExynosPrimaryDisplayModule.cpp b/libhwc2.1/libmaindisplay/ExynosPrimaryDisplayModule.cpp index 1dd2fc5..e4779a6 100644 --- a/libhwc2.1/libmaindisplay/ExynosPrimaryDisplayModule.cpp +++ b/libhwc2.1/libmaindisplay/ExynosPrimaryDisplayModule.cpp @@ -605,11 +605,7 @@ int32_t ExynosPrimaryDisplayModule::DisplaySceneInfo::setLayerColorData( layerData.dim_ratio = layer->mPreprocessedInfo.sdrDimRatio; setLayerDataspace(layerData, static_cast<hwc::Dataspace>(layer->mDataSpace)); - if (layer->mIsHdrLayer) { - if (layer->getMetaParcel() == nullptr) { - HDEBUGLOGE("%s:: meta data parcel is null", __func__); - return -EINVAL; - } + if (layer->mIsHdrLayer && layer->getMetaParcel() != nullptr) { if (layer->getMetaParcel()->eType & VIDEO_INFO_TYPE_HDR_STATIC) setLayerHdrStaticMetadata(layerData, layer->getMetaParcel()->sHdrStaticInfo); else |